Answer to Question 1

c
Rationale: a. Dextrose would further elevate blood sugar levels.
b. Insulin is not administered in the field and must be carefully administered according to patient need.
c. Correct.
d. Glucagon would cause an increase in blood sugar levels.

Complications of influenza include: bacterial pneumonia, ear and sinus infections, dehydration, and worsening of chronic conditions such as asthma, congestive heart failure, or diabetes.

When intravenous medications are involved in adverse drug events, their harmful effects may occur more rapidly, and be more severe than errors with oral medications. This is due to the direct administration into the bloodstream.
